無変換キーを鬼のように使い倒すスレ
- 8 :unnamed.ahk:2008/04/18(金) 00:13:13
- vi 風カーソル移動
vk1Dsc07B & h::withShiftKey("Left")
vk1Dsc07B & j::withShiftKey("Down")
vk1Dsc07B & k::withShiftKey("Up")
vk1Dsc07B & l::withShiftKey("Right")
withShiftKey(keyName) {
modifier := ""
GetKeyState, state, Ctrl
if (state = "D")
modifier := modifier . "^"
GetKeyState, state, Alt
if (state = "D")
modifier := modifier . "!"
GetKeyState, state, Shift
if (state = "D")
modifier := modifier . "+"
Send, %modifier%{%keyName%}
return
}
3KB
0ch BBS 2005-10-08